I just recently upgraded my current setup. I used to have an ASUS P5GC-MX motherboard in my old setup, with 2GB of DDR2 RAM, a 150GB HDD for primary storage (7200RPM, Hitachi DeskStar), Intel Core2Duo Processor (2.2GhZ), nVidia GeForce 210 (512MB) GPU.

I swapped this out for the following parts:

1. ASUS P8H67-M LX Motherboard
- 6 SATA ports, 2 of which are 6GB/s SATA connectors
- capacity for up to 16GB of DDR3 RAM
2. CoolerMaster eXtreme Power Plus 550W PSU
3. Kingston 4GB DDR3 RAM
4. Intel Core i3-2105, 3.10GhZ
5. Kept my current GPU (nVidia GeForce 210 - 512MB), but thinking of upgrading to nVidia GeForce GTX 465 (1GB DDR5)
6. Windows 7: Ultimate Edition (x86), SP1

Any other suggested upgrades?

Google the PSU for reviews...The CM exteme power was NOT highly thought of, to say the least! I would recommend a Corsair, Seasonic, Antec, PCP&C or Enermax in the same wattage range.
